We walked for Dave Parcells who was just recently diagnosed with MS as a suprise and show of support. He was in Florida this past week for the Tampa Bay Marathon Swim and did not know about what we going to do. He had participated in the marathon several times before, winning in 2003 and crowned the "King of Tamp Bay." I learned this Monday morning as i came into work that Dave passed away Saturday while doing what he loved to do. While in the race he felt nausious and signaled for help. He was picked up by the escorting boats and told them he didnt feel well. He suffered a heart attack and they were not able to revive him.
This is a shock to everyone knowing him. He was someone who was very determined to get things done, very athletic and MS was not going to get in his way. He was involved with many charities and fundraisers. Here are some links to events he has done as well as this past Saturdays article.
